南京晰视电子

arm9用哪个指令集(armv9指令集)

本篇目录:

ARM7,ARM9,ARM11等有啥区别?

1、ARM处理器根据不同的应用场景和性能需求,推出了多个不同的内核和产品系列,如ARMARMARM1Cortex等。

2、ARM9E从ARM7的3级流水线增加到了5级,ARM9E的流水线中容纳了更多的逻辑操作,但是每一级的逻辑操作却变得更为简单。

arm9用哪个指令集(armv9指令集)-图1

3、arm7没有保护模式需要MMU单元,功能上来说一般用作实时控制系统。arm9以上都有MMU单元,功能比arm7有很大提高,采用了伪哈弗结构,指令处理速度快很多。由于有MMU,所以arm9以上就可以运行嵌入式linux和wince等操作系统。

4、ARM7,arm9,arm11,cortex M0/M3分别代表ARM处理器的一个系列。

5、cortex是arm公司推出的以V7指令集设计出来的一系列arm核,其中包括Cortex-M1,Cortex-M0,Cortex-M4。arm7 使用V4指令集 。arm9 使用V5指令集。arm10 使用V5指令集。arm11 使用V6指令集。

arm9用哪个指令集(armv9指令集)-图2

arm9和cortex-a对比

1、ARM9大部分使用ARM v4(T)架构,而Cortex A9使用的是ARM v7架构,Cortex A9比ARM 9添加了NEON加速引擎(做视频、音频数据处理时很有用)、FPU硬单元(用于浮点计算)、L2缓存控制接口等。

2、市场上常见的armarm1cortex Acortex A9都是指arm架构的核心,其中armarm11主要应用于经济型产品,都是中低端的,cortex Acortex A9主要应用于高端产品,比如苹果iPhone等。

3、arm9和arm11都是针对中低端市场 , Cortexa8针对中高端市场。 arm9和arm11的架构一样,但是ARM9成本较高比ARM11高 arm11主要是频率取胜,由于超高的频率,在2D坏境中的运行能力超强,甚至超过95。

arm9用哪个指令集(armv9指令集)-图3

4、arm9和arm11区别不大,只是性能上的提高,然后arm11增加了图形处理的能力。arm7都还不过时。外面找工作,我是刚好是应届生,这个对我来说实际的经验要求不高。但你用AR9\ARM11肯定不是过时的。

5、cortex架构:ARM公司在经典处理器ARM11以后的产品改用Cortex命名,并分成A、R和M三类,旨在为各种不同的市场提供服务。arm内核和cortex架构的区别:构架不一样:arm内核:RM处理器本身是32位设计,但也配备16位指令集。

比较ARMv7指令集与ARMv6指令集具有哪些变化

1、ARM 架构与精简指令集计算 (RISC) 架构类似,因为它包含以下典型 RISC 架构特征:统一寄存器文件加载/存储架构,其中的数据处理操作只针对寄存器内容,并不直接针对内存内容。

2、它优化了ARMv7指令集的表现,支持更先进的CPU指令,如浮点运算和NEON SIMD指令,能够提升应用程序的执行效率和速度,同时能够进行更加复杂的计算和处理任务。开发者可以利用它开发出更加高效、功能完善的Android应用程序。

3、没听说过ARM1。但对ARM来说有两大类汇编指令:ARM指令和thumb指令。thumb指令有16和32位,ARM指令位32位。对每一类来说,不用去关心解码实现的话,总体是一样的。

4、cortex-a8构架的都用armv7指令集,这是嵌入式系统开发的基础知识,ARM系列目前最新最先进的指令集,对应的就是ARMCortex-A8/A9系列(A9应该算是改进型ARMV7指令集),前一代的ARM11处理器用的是ARMV6指令集。

5、我用过PALM650、680、centro三个,也曾经考虑过pre。

6、arm32位和64位的区别如下:Arm32位是ARMV7架构,32位的,对应处理器为Cortex-A15等,ARMV7-A和ARMV7-R系列支持neon指令集,ARMv7-M系列不支持neon指令集。

应用嵌入式主板的好处都有哪些呢?

)、功耗:这是ARM主板最大的优点之一,一般的VIA的X86主板,功耗都在40W左右或者以上,而ARM主板的功耗极低,如:微嵌的工业平板电脑(使用ARM架构),在关掉背光情况下,其主板功耗整体也只有1W左右。

嵌入式主板是经过专门设计,可以满足工业要求地工业主板。嵌入式主板可以通过各种尺寸形式提供给各种应用,而这些模块可以单独提供,也可以集成安装到需要计算组件地机器当中,也可以作为完整解决方案地一部分,应用起来相当地灵活。

具有速度快、工作方式灵活、可靠性高、信息处理能力强、成本低、适用范围广等特点。在工业领域中已得到广泛的应用,选用功能强大的32位嵌入式微处理器来代替8位单片机。

根据实际嵌入式应用要求,将嵌入式微处理器装配在专门设计的主板上,只保留和嵌入式应用有关的主板功能,这样可以大幅度减小系统的体积和功耗。

嵌入式的ARM板一般都是板载CPU,而基于x86 CPU的主板则不一定。很多高端的嵌入式主板都不再板载CPU,使用Socket P/Socket M的CPU槽,所以用户可以很方面地根据自己的性能需求选择主板支持的CPU。

嵌入式系统以应用为中心,以微电子技术、控制技术、计算机技术和通讯技术为基础,强调硬件软件的协同性与整合性,软件与硬件可剪裁,以此满足系统对功能、成本、体积和功耗等要求。

到此,以上就是小编对于armv9指令集的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

分享:
扫描分享到社交APP
上一篇
下一篇